The European Union (EU) is trying to attract more small- and medium-size enterprises to participate in its long-running CleanSky joint technology program. With public funds available to back research-and-development work aimed at reducing the environmental impact of air transport, it hopes to spread such support beyond major aerospace firms. Those companies, in turn, want to spread the risk of involvement in some of the lower-tier work.

To kick off the initiative, EU officials held a conference for prospective new partners in Toulouse, France, on January 31. They plan to hold a similar event in Spain in March, followed by presentations in Portugal and several other European states over the coming months.
